The Swiss National Bank (SNB), founded in 1907 and headquartered in Zurich with an office in Bern, is Switzerland’s central bank, responsible for conducting monetary policy, issuing the Swiss franc, and ensuring price stability, while uniquely managing a massive investment portfolio. Unlike most central banks, the SNB is a joint-stock company with shares traded on the SIX Swiss Exchange, owned roughly 55% by public entities like cantons and 45% by private investors, yet it operates independently under federal oversight. It holds over $800 billion in foreign currency reserves as of late 2024—invested in global equities, bonds, and gold—to manage the franc’s value, famously intervening in markets to prevent excessive appreciation, as seen with the 2015 abandonment of the euro peg. Led by Chairman Thomas Jordan until his planned exit in September 2024, the SNB balances its dual role as a monetary authority and a significant global investor, influencing both Swiss and international financial stability.

Swiss National Bank's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Swiss National Bank held 2,722 positions worth $177B, up 6.8% from $166B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

Swiss National Bank deployed $20.2B of net new capital in Q1 2022, opening 3 new positions and adding to 2,642 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Constellation Energy: 1,411,783 shares worth $79.4M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 28% of assets, down from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Exelon, an estimated $41.2M trimmed.
